HFCS Boys Hoop Team Beats Bengals

January 8, 2010 By eastwickpress

by Gary Danforth
On Tuesday evening, January 5, the Hoosick Falls Central School varsity boys basketball team went on a 16-0 run to start the third quarter and ended up with a hard earned 66-45 win over Brittonkill-Tamarac Central School for Coach Mike Lilac Jr.’s 199th career win at HFCS. Recycle Christmas Trees At GLSP

January 8, 2010 By eastwickpress

Grafton Lakes State Park is accepting Christmas trees for recycling now. The trees will be recycled or reused in ways that benefit the Park and the public.  Please drop off trees, emptied of all decorations, to the Park’s maintenance shop between the hours of 8 am and 3:30 pm until January 17.

Upcoming Grafton Lakes State Park Events

January 8, 2010 By eastwickpress

Ice Skating is available on Long Pond from 10 am to 4 pm weather and ice conditions permitting. There is no fee to enjoy pond skating, but participants must bring their own ice skates.
